Ingredients
Juicy cherries, rich chocolate, and bold mocha chips—these cookies are sweet, indulgent, and unapologetically addictive. Eat responsibly (or don’t).
Ingredients:
– 1 ¾ cups all-purpose flour
– ½ tsp baking soda
– ¼ tsp salt
– ¾ cup unsalted butter (softened)
– 1 cup brown sugar (packed)
– ¼ cup granulated sugar
– 1 large egg
– 1 ½ tsp vanilla extract
– ½ cup dark chocolate chips
– ½ cup mocha chips
– ½ cup dried cherries (chopped)
How to Make Cherry Chocolate Chip Cookies with Mocha Chips
Step 1: Preheat the Oven
Set your oven to 350°F (175°C) and line a baking sheet with parchment paper to prevent sticking.
Step 2: Mix Dry Ingredients
In a bowl, combine:
1. all-purpose flour
2. baking soda
3. salt
Mix well until fully incorporated.
Step 3: Cream Butter & Sugars
In another mixing bowl:
1. Beat together unsalted butter, brown sugar, and granulated sugar until the mixture is fluffy and light.
Step 4: Add Egg & Vanilla
Add in:
1. The large egg
2. The vanilla extract
Mix until smooth and well combined.
Step 5: Combine Wet & Dry Ingredients
Gradually stir in the flour mixture until just blended—be careful not to overmix.
Step 6: Fold in Chocolate, Mocha, and Cherries
Gently fold in:
1. dark chocolate chips
2. mocha chips
3. dried cherries
Ensure they are evenly distributed throughout the dough.
Step 7: Scoop & Shape
Using a cookie scoop or tablespoon, drop dough balls onto the prepared baking sheet, keeping space between each for spreading.
Step 8: Bake
Place the baking sheet in the oven and bake for about 10-12 minutes or until the edges turn golden brown.
Step 9: Cool & Eat
Once baked, let the cookies cool on a wire rack before digging in immediately! Enjoy your delicious Cherry Chocolate Chip Cookies with Mocha Chips.

How to Perfect Cherry Chocolate Chip Cookies with Mocha Chips
To achieve the best texture and flavor in your Cherry Chocolate Chip Cookies with Mocha Chips, keep these tips in mind.
- Use room temperature ingredients – Ensure butter and eggs are at room temperature for easy mixing and better incorporation.
- Don’t overmix the dough – Mix just until combined to keep your cookies soft and chewy.
- Chill the dough – Refrigerate the dough for at least 30 minutes before baking to help the flavors meld and prevent spreading.
- Watch baking times – Keep an eye on your cookies; they should be golden around the edges but still soft in the center when you take them out.
- Store properly – Keep leftover cookies in an airtight container to maintain their freshness and chewiness.

Common Mistakes to Avoid
When baking Cherry Chocolate Chip Cookies with Mocha Chips, it’s easy to make small errors that can impact the final product. Here are some common mistakes to watch for.
- Skipping the flour measurement: Always measure your flour accurately. Too much or too little can change the cookie’s texture.
- Not softening butter properly: If the butter isn’t softened enough, it won’t cream well with sugars. Make sure it’s at room temperature for best results.
- Overmixing the dough: Mixing too long after adding flour can lead to tough cookies. Mix just until combined for a tender treat.
- Ignoring cooling time: Letting cookies cool on a wire rack is essential. If you skip this, they might crumble or lose their shape.
- Using stale ingredients: Check your baking soda and other ingredients for freshness. Stale ingredients can affect both taste and rise.
Refrigerator Storage
- Store in an airtight container for up to 1 week.
- Place parchment paper between layers if stacking to prevent sticking.
Freezing Cherry Chocolate Chip Cookies with Mocha Chips
- Freeze cookies in a single layer on a baking sheet before transferring them to a freezer-safe bag.
- They will last up to 3 months in the freezer.
Reheating Cherry Chocolate Chip Cookies with Mocha Chips
- Oven: Preheat to 350°F (175°C) and heat for 5-10 minutes until warm.
- Microwave: Heat for about 10-15 seconds per cookie for a soft texture.
- Stovetop: Place in a skillet over low heat, turning occasionally until warmed through.
Frequently Asked Questions
Can I use fresh cherries instead of dried?
You can use fresh cherries, but they may add extra moisture, affecting the cookie’s texture. Consider reducing other liquid ingredients slightly.
How do I make these cookies gluten-free?
Substitute all-purpose flour with a gluten-free flour blend. Ensure that other ingredients are also gluten-free.
What can I replace mocha chips with?
If you can’t find mocha chips, try using more dark chocolate chips or even white chocolate chips for a different flavor profile.
Can I add nuts to the Cherry Chocolate Chip Cookies with Mocha Chips?
Absolutely! Chopped walnuts or pecans would complement the flavors beautifully.
How do I know when my cookies are done baking?
Look for golden edges and a soft center; they will continue cooking on the baking sheet after being removed from the oven.
